The OWL dialog used <t t-out="m.body"/> on message bodies, but t-out escapes plain strings — it only renders raw when the value is a Markup instance. Bodies arrive over JSON-RPC as plain strings (Markup is a client-side type, doesn't cross the wire), so the customer was seeing literal "<p>This has been fixed.</p>" in the thread instead of the rendered HTML. Wrap incoming bodies in `markup()` at the boundary (openTicket + sendReply call sites) so the template renders them as the sanitised HTML the central chatter already produced. Trust is fine — the body is sanitised server-side by mail.thread before it ever leaves nexa. Bumps fusion_helpdesk to 19.0.1.7.1.
